There are two degenerate modes for circular waveguides, one is E-H degeneration, and the other is polarization degeneration. In a waveguide with one inner layer, a mode angle (output in degrees) can be associated with a guided mode, defined by cos () = /kn 1 = N eff /n 1; this refers to the common ray picture for confined wave propagation in a single core waveguide. Most actual waveguides are not uniform and infinite in the y-direction but can be approximated as slab waveguides if their width W is much larger than the core thickness d, as shown below. all refractive 3 TEm,n Mode Guide Wavelength.
